Transaction 21cf07ec09f8a258e3498e50ed59a8e4d192724760c2b0384ab594485280dbbd
2 Input
2 Outputs
- 21cf07ec09f8a258e3498e50ed59a8e4d192724760c2b0384ab594485280dbbd:0
- 21cf07ec09f8a258e3498e50ed59a8e4d192724760c2b0384ab594485280dbbd:1
value 5000032
address 1Q5o74cz4jr77dd45VSyYy7p2JXRuDAGhF
value 1000806
address 1N8gPctsM1hkgNSvBD1uGgQBrREn8cRmTw